1. Overview
Więcej Słońca is Bolter’s debut studio album, released in 1986 on the Polish label Wifon (LP-090). It captures the band’s early synth-pop sound and includes the enduring hit Daj Mi Tę Noc, helping establish Bolter as a defining act of Poland’s 1980s pop scene. The record’s significance is underscored by later revivals and continued discussion of Bolter’s legacy. - Awards: The single Daj Mi Tę Noc won a main prize at Opole’s Festival Premiers (1985), contributing to Bolter’s prominence surrounding the album cycle. ([radiotop.pl](https://radiotop.pl/daj-mi-te-noc-hit-bolter-powrocil-w-odswiezonej-wersji/?utm_source=openai))

- Covers/samples: “Więcej Słońca Nam Się Marzy” was sampled/covered in later years, notably by Love System (2000). ([whosampled.com](https://www.whosampled.com/Bolter/Wi%C4%99cej-S%C5%82o%C5%84ca-Nam-Si%C4%99-Marzy/?utm_source=openai))
